menu: support <action name="Execute"> option <execute>

<exectue> is a deprecated name for <command>.
See: http://openbox.org/wiki/Help:Actions#Action_syntax

But some openbox3 menu generators still use it, for example
https://wiki.archlinux.org/title/xdg-menu - so let's support it for
backward compatibility.
